Weather Situation
A cold southwesterly airstream moves over Victoria today following a cold front passing over the east of the state this morning. A trough will move across Bass Strait in the wake of the front then a high pressure ridge will move across from the west on Thursday and Friday. The ridge will move eastwards on Saturday.
